Any ideas on the power part of the circuit before I move on to the small signal stuff?
The board is going to be double sided but not plated through so capactiors and similar can only be directly connected to the lower layer, that's the reason there's so little stuff on the upper layer yet. The output transistors are NJL1302/NJL3281 driven by CFP-connected drivers/predrivers. It isn't finished as you might see |
